Apus Peru is interested in building the capacity of their staff, many who have indigenous backgrounds or live in remote communities. They run an annual training day where topics include
  • wilderness first aid
  • good environmental practice
  • customer service
  • hygiene
  • equipment care
  • new dishes/ plates (cooks)
  • the training day is also an opportunity to reflect on the achievements of the year and work on teamwork.
